Transaction 803c80bb02f911988f0206f9e20ef2ce21ef55d7fa4a164db42ce9ae32dd00e9
1 Input
1 Output
-
803c80bb02f911988f0206f9e20ef2ce21ef55d7fa4a164db42ce9ae32dd00e9:0
- value
- 24239821
- script pubkey
- OP_0 OP_PUSHBYTES_20 c0bbaf8ec7ba0cb45de1542c230608e237c685ae
- address
- bc1qcza6lrk8hgxtgh0p2skzxpsgugmudpdwnyjslp